I have a question re corrupt files, namely, what can one do about them?
A number of files on this team project are causing Word to freeze up for me. This is also happening to two other team members. The weirdest issue is below, but I assume it is related. Pretty sure we're all on PCs.
I have run virus scans on my computer to no avail. Otherwise I'm not having issues on my general system.
I suspect the source of the problem is the art being inserted into the textbook chapters as text files from the same source don't seem to cause any problems for me. Since it is a common license book, image files are coming from the Internet. (I know, but there is no way around this.)
Is there some sort of "clean this file" freeware I should look into?
Weird problem:
This morning, when I opened the Chapter 19 file, it only shows pages 1-19 in the “All Markup” track changes mode. This is the mode I have used in the past to show all insertions, deletions, etc.
I can only see/edit all 49 pages in the “Simple Markup” track changes mode, which only shows the vertical red line in the margin to indicate any changes in the text (without highlighting any exact insertions or deletions).
Thoughts? Advice?
Mostly I'm dealing with it by scrupulously saving files in progress but obviously that's not great long term. Help appreciated!
Have you tried the trick that I think is referred to as "the Maggie"?
Copy the whole document, minus the final paragraph mark, into a new document. Sometimes that can get rid of funky problems.
Yes, I did that for one of the writers on one file, and I think it helped but the file was still a bit funky.
I was hoping for something more systematic as there are 32 chapters in this book being circulated among the team and reviewers for multiple rounds.
